Description
Indicates the key is configured to automatically activate specific services offered
by the server. For example, if the sprecode value of *82 is configured, then by
pressing the Sprecode key, *82 automatically activates a service provided by the
server. Contact your System Administrator for available services.
Indicates the key is configured to park incoming calls when pressed.
Indicates the key is configured to pick up parked calls when pressed.
Indicates the key is configured as a Call Forward key. When pressed, the IP
Phone UI displays the Call Forward menus.
Indicates the key is configured as a simplified BLF key and a transfer key. You
can use this key to perform the BLF function, or you can use it as a transfer key
to transfer calls.
Indicates the key is configured as a simplified speed dial key and a transfer key.
You can use this key to perform speed dial functions, or you can use it as a
transfer key to transfer calls.
Indicates the key is configured as a speed dial key and a conference key. You
can use this key to speed dial from within a conference call, and add the new
call directly to the conference.
Indicates the key is configured to be used for intercom calls.
Indicates the key is set to access Services, such as, Directory List, Callers List,
Voicemail, or any other XML applications set up by your System Administrator.
Indicates the key is configured as a phone lock key, allowing you to press this
key to lock/unlock the phone.
Indicates the key is configured as a Paging key. When pressed, the phone can
